Allegheny Financial Group Advisors Among Top Wealth Managers

Pittsburgh Magazine survey of 41,000 area residents rated satisfaction with advisors

PITTSBURGH, 25 June 2009 - An extensive survey of Pittsburgh-area residents with high net worth has identified thirteen advisors from Allegheny Financial Group and its affiliates among the region's top wealth managers on the basis of clients' satisfaction. The independent survey, sponsored by Pittsburgh Magazine, ranked financial planners, accountants, tax advisors, insurance agents, bankers and other professional financial advisors on performance in relation to nine criteria— customer service, integrity, knowledge & expertise, communications, value for fee, meeting of objectives, post-sale service, quality of recommendations and overall satisfaction.

Allegheny Financial Group principals James D. Hohman, Karl Smrekar, Jr., Raymond Schutzman, Jennifer Schrauder, Michael Montileone, Deborah Turek, Steven Hurst, Steve Kutlenios, and Ralph Boyd, Jr., and affiliated advisors Thomas R. Butler, Ralph Duckworth, Carol K. Lampe, and Thomas Windfelder were named to the magazine's list of Five-Star Wealth Managers, the top performers identified from the survey.

"The survey results— and the number of Five-Star designations— reflect our advisory depth," said Allegheny Senior Vice President David Jeter.

In all, the Five-Star designation was awarded to fewer than seven percent of all financial advisors in the region. A description of the survey and its methodology appeared in the July 2009 issue of Pittsburgh Magazine.
